Ruttl is a web-based platform that streamlines feedback gathering by allowing users to pinpoint exact elements on a webpage and leave detailed comments. This visual approach eliminates confusion and helps developers and designers understand precisely what adjustments are needed. Its real-time collaboration features enable multiple users to contribute simultaneously, keeping all feedback centralized and easy to track.
The simplicity of Ruttl’s interface means teams can begin using it quickly without complicated installations. By just entering a website’s URL, users can start reviewing and annotating pages immediately. This ease of use benefits both internal teams and external collaborators such as clients or freelancers, making it accessible regardless of technical expertise. As a ruttl website collaboration tool, it supports seamless communication and task management within a single environment.
Ruttl also integrates with various project management and communication tools, allowing feedback to fit naturally within existing workflows. Its version control system preserves a history of changes and comments, which is essential for tracking the progression of web projects and maintaining accountability over time. Security measures ensure that sensitive data and client information are protected throughout the process.

ruttl offers a free trial allowing users to test the platform before choosing a paid plan.
Basic Plan
Cost: $12 per user per month (billed annually)
Includes unlimited projects and tasks
Real-time collaboration and commenting
Basic integrations with popular tools
Pro Plan
Cost: $20 per user per month (billed annually)
All features in Basic Plan
Advanced integrations and workflow automation
Priority support and enhanced security features

Frequently Asked Questions about ruttl
How does Ruttl enhance collaboration on web projects?
Ruttl allows multiple participants to leave detailed, contextual comments directly on live websites or prototypes. This direct annotation helps reduce confusion, streamlines communication, and speeds up project delivery by making feedback clear and actionable.
Is Ruttl compatible with the platforms we commonly use?
Yes. Ruttl overlays its feedback tools on live sites, staging environments, or prototypes without requiring any code integration, making it compatible with a wide range of website platforms and content management systems.
Can external clients or contractors easily contribute feedback?
Absolutely. Ruttl enables inviting external stakeholders to view and comment on projects without the need for full user accounts, facilitating straightforward collaboration across teams and clients.
Does Ruttl support tracking feedback over time?
While not a traditional version control system, Ruttl keeps a comprehensive history of comments and responses, allowing teams to monitor progress and changes throughout the project lifecycle.
What devices and browsers does Ruttl support For feedback?
Ruttl works seamlessly across modern web browsers and supports most devices, including desktops, laptops, tablets, and smartphones, enabling feedback from virtually anywhere.
Is a free trial available to evaluate Ruttl?
Ruttl typically offers a free trial or demo period, allowing users to explore its functionalities and assess suitability before committing to a subscription plan.
Does Ruttl integrate with other project management tools?
Ruttl supports integration with popular project management and collaboration platforms, helping users maintain smooth workflows, although specific integrations may vary with platform updates.
How secure is data shared through Ruttl?
Security measures include encrypted connections and secure data storage, ensuring that client feedback and project information remain confidential and protected.
Is installation or Software download required to use Ruttl?
No installation is necessary; Ruttl is fully web-based and accessed through browsers, simplifying the onboarding process and eliminating the need for local software.
Are there any limitations when providing feedback on dynamic or interactive websites?
Ruttl supports feedback on most website elements, but highly dynamic or interactive components may present some constraints depending on how content loads or updates in real time.
What kind of customer support and training does Ruttl offer?
Users have access to documentation, tutorials, and direct support channels designed to help them effectively utilize the software and resolve any issues.
